Milwaukee M18 Fuel Polishers stand out in the market for their superior power, precision, and cordless convenience, catering to a wide range of professional needs. These polishers are designed with Milwaukee's advanced REDLINK PLUS intelligence, ensuring optimal performance and protection against overloads. The brushless motors deliver consistent power and longer run times, making these polishers perfect for extended use in demanding environments. Additionally, the M18 battery system provides seamless compatibility with a wide array of Milwaukee tools, allowing users to maximize their productivity and efficiency on the job site.
Milwaukee offers M18 Fuel Polishers in different sizes, each tailored to specific tasks and user preferences. The most common sizes include 7-inch and 5-inch polishers. The 7-inch polishers are preferred for larger surface areas, delivering powerful and efficient polishing, making them ideal for automotive and marine applications. On the other hand, the 5-inch polishers are more compact and provide greater control, which is essential for precision work and smaller surfaces. The choice of size depends largely on the specific requirements of the job, with larger polishers excelling in coverage and smaller ones offering detailed precision.
Professionals prefer different sizes of polishers based on the nature of their work and the surfaces they need to polish. For instance, automotive detailers often choose the 7-inch polishers for their ability to cover large areas quickly and effectively, reducing the time needed to achieve a high-gloss finish on vehicles. Conversely, the 5-inch polishers are favored by those who need to navigate tighter spaces and achieve finer details, such as in woodworking, where precise control is crucial for finishing intricate designs. The ergonomic design and balanced weight distribution of Milwaukee M18 Fuel Polishers further enhance user comfort and control, making them a top choice among professionals.
Common trades and applications for Milwaukee M18 Fuel Polishers span across various industries. Automotive detailers rely on these polishers for restoring and maintaining the appearance of vehicles, ensuring a showroom-quality finish. Marine professionals use them to polish and protect the surfaces of boats and yachts, preserving their aesthetic and functional integrity. In the woodworking and furniture-making industries, polishers are essential for achieving smooth, polished finishes on wooden surfaces and furniture pieces. Additionally, these polishers are utilized in metal fabrication and construction for polishing and finishing metal surfaces, ensuring a professional-grade result. Milwaukee M18 Fuel Polishers, with their range of sizes and capabilities, offer the versatility and performance needed to meet the diverse demands of these trades.
